  • Pickups for an Ibanez semi hollow

    I've got an Ibanez AJD81T which I love and it came loaded with Dimarzio PAF Joe (neck) and Steve's Special (bridge) by the previous owner. I'm looking for pickups that work well in jazz and fusion and these Dimarzios aren't doing it for me. Any suggestions?

    • #3
      Re: Pickups for an Ibanez semi hollow

      I'm looking for something that sounds like Pat Metheny. Warm tone with just enough articulation. The current pickups are a little too spiky in my opinion.

      • #4
        Re: Pickups for an Ibanez semi hollow

        Originally posted by jay_ouch View Post
        I'm looking for something that sounds like Pat Metheny. Warm tone with just enough articulation. The current pickups are a little too spiky in my opinion.
        Ok. So, my advice would be the APH1n, even though an A2 modded '59n would do great as well.

        A Seth Lover neck and/or a Pearly Gates neck could do no wrong either.

        EDIT: I own a Gibson L-5 CES all-maple copy and it's loaded with an A3 neck / A2 bridge modded Duncan Jazz set. This guitar uses 11-56 flatwound strings. This is the most articulated p'up set known to mankind, if you ask me. To bring in the warmth, I use .047 caps.
